With the United States and France openly discussing the prospects of a military strike on Syria, Israel is on high alert for any potential spillover across the border or retaliatory rocket fire against the Jewish state. Israeli army jeeps continue to patrol the strategic Golan Heights border region, which Israel captured from Syria during the 1967 Six-Day War
